WebJan 1, 2024 · The annual gift tax exclusion For 2024, the Internal Revenue Service (IRS) allows individuals to make gifts of up to $17,000 per year to an unlimited number of individuals, with no federal gift or estate tax consequences. A spouse can give the same amount—doubling the amount a couple can gift.

WebWhen considering tax on cash gifts, it’s important to remember that everyone has a £3,000 annual gift exemption. In theory, this means that every parent can give up to £3,000 in tax-free cash gifts to their children every year. It’s important to note, however, that the £3,000 allowance applies to the total value of all cash gifts.
